Nfts (non Fungible Tokens) For Credentials

NFTs (non-fungible tokens) for credentials are digital representations of certificates, diplomas, professional licenses, or achievement acknowledgments stored on blockchain technology. They aim to provide a secure, immutable, and easily verifiable way to authenticate and transmit credentials across various institutions and individuals, reducing fraud and streamlining verification processes.

Key Features

  • Unique digital ownership of credentials
  • Blockchain-based immutability and security
  • Ease of verification without intermediaries
  • Potential for lifelong and tamper-proof records
  • Facilitation of global access and transparency
  • Integration with existing credentialing systems

Pros

  • Enhances security and reduces credential fraud
  • Streamlines verification processes for employers and institutions
  • Provides a permanent record that is easily accessible worldwide
  • Offers potential cost savings over traditional verification methods
  • Supports digital innovation in education and professional development

Cons

  • Still an emerging technology with lacking standardization
  • Potential accessibility issues for those unfamiliar with blockchain
  • Environmental concerns related to blockchain energy consumption
  • Legal and regulatory frameworks are not fully established
  • Risk of loss or theft if private keys are mishandled
